Address

DMw7o5ystzZCUV12PNbApDzkDoPS95SNmoCopy

Total Received

6455.32004913 DOGE

Total Sent

6452.25304913 DOGE

№ Transactions

437

Final Balance

3.067 DOGE

Transactions
Filter